How much do remote computer programming j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ote computer programming in Mississippi is $61,535.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47,800.00 and $75,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is remote computer programming?

Remote computer programming involves writing, testing, and maintaining software code from a location outside of a traditional office, typically from home or another remote setting. Programmers collaborate with teams using digital tools, version control systems, and communication platforms to build software solutions. This arrangement offers flexibility, but also requires strong communication skills, self-discipline, and familiarity with remote work technologies. Many companies offer remote computer programming positions to access a global talent pool and provide employees with a better work-life balance.

What are some common challenges faced by remote computer programmers and how can they be addressed?

Remote computer programmers often encounter challenges related to communication, collaboration, and time management. Without in-person interactions, it can be harder to clarify requirements, coordinate with team members, or stay informed about project updates. To address these challenges, successful remote programmers proactively use collaboration tools, attend regular virtual meetings, and maintain clear, written documentation. Building strong communication habits and setting structured work schedules also help maintain productivity and foster effective teamwork.

KēSTA I.T is actively seeking a Oracle Primavera Unifier Administrator for an immediate contract engagement with our government client.

Work Location: This position is Remote

Job Description:

We Are Seeking an experienced Unifier & Web Services Administrator to support the administration, maintenance, enhancement, and modernization of enterprise project management and web-based applications. This role is responsible for maintaining Oracle Primavera Unifier environments, supporting business process configurations, developing and maintaining web applications,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to deliver scalable, secure, and reliable solutions. The ideal candidate will possess deep technical expertise in Oracle Primavera Unifier, Microsoft development technologies, web services, and relational databases, along with strong communication and problem-solving skills.

Responsibilities:

·         Administer, maintain, and support Oracle Primavera Unifier (version 26.6 and higher).

·         Configure and maintain business processes, data views, user-defined reports, and BI custom print templates.

·         Identify, troubleshoot, and resolve application configuration issues while providing ongoing system support.

·         Assist application administrators with first-level user support and technical issue resolution.

·         Maintain and enhance existing ASP and ASP.NET applications supporting enterprise reservation and project management systems.

·         Design, develop, and implement a new web-based reservation application integrated with Oracle Primavera Unifier.

·         Upgrade existing applications from .NET Core 8 to .NET Core 10 while ensuring application stability and performance.

·         Develop, maintain, and support web applications using C#, ASP.NET, Blazor, Razor Pages, and .NET technologies.

·         Develop and optimize Oracle SQL and MySQL database queries, stored procedures, and data integrations.

·         Configure, administer, and troubleshoot IIS and Windows Server environments.

·         Collaborate with business stakeholders, developers, administrators, and technical teams to deliver application enhancements and system improvements.

·         Produce and maintain technical documentation, application configurations, and system support documentation.

·         Participate in application testing, system patching, deployments, and off-hours maintenance activities as needed.

·         Provide knowledge transfer, cross-training, and technical guidance to internal team members.

·         Ensure applications follow security, performance, and organizational best practices.

Required Skills:

·         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.

·         Extensive experience administering Oracle Primavera Unifier (version 26.6 or higher).

·         Advanced experience developing applications with .NET Framework and .NET Core.

·         Expert-level proficiency with C# development.

·         Advanced experience with ASP.NET, Blazor, and Razor Pages.

·         Strong experience developing and supporting Oracle SQL and MySQL databases.

·         Experience maintaining and upgrading enterprise web applications.

·         Strong knowledge of IIS administration and web application hosting.

·         Experience supporting Windows Server environments (2016, 2019, 2022, and 2025).

·         Ability to identify and resolve application configuration and performance issues.

·         Excellent anal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ills.

·         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to collaborate across technical and business teams.

·         Ability to manage multiple priorities while working independently and within a collaborative team environment.
